Domain and website signals to inspect

Practical due diligence starts with the domain and site safety indicators. Look for a legitimate domain name registered for multiple years, transparent ownership information via a Whois record, and a valid SSL certificate (https). Check for consistent branding across pages, clearly stated policies, and functional help channels (live chat, email, or phone). A reputable platform will host policy pages in accessible language and avoid overly generic terms. We also evaluate whether the site provides seller onboarding information, terms of service, and a privacy policy that explains data handling. If key signals are missing or obscured, treat the listing as higher risk and proceed with caution. Print Setup Pro recommends taking screenshots of policies for later reference and cross-checking them against independent sources.

Payment methods, refunds, and buyer protections

Payment security matters as much as product quality. Favor platforms that offer protected payment options (credit cards, escrow-like services, or reputable digital wallets) and well-defined refunds and return terms. Clarity around shipping timelines, fulfillment windows, and processing times reduces buyer risk. If a seller has inconsistent or vague refund policies, or if the platform discourages disputes or chargebacks, consider it a red flag. A legitimate marketplace will also provide a clear process for reporting issues, including evidence requirements (photos, order numbers, and communication logs). Print Setup Pro stresses testing a small order when dealing with a new platform to validate the end-to-end experience before committing to larger purchases.

Seller transparency and product listing quality

Because Printerval operates as a marketplace, the credibility of the listing often hinges on the individual seller rather than the platform alone. Evaluate product descriptions for accuracy, listing images of sufficient quality, and the inclusion of size, color, material, and printing method details. Compare listings across sellers to identify outliers—significantly mismatched descriptions or inconsistent imagery can signal unreliable sellers. Check whether the site displays seller ratings, response times, and verified badges. A trustworthy market typically surfaces seller-specific policies, ensures consistent fulfillment performance, and provides an avenue to contact the seller directly to resolve questions before purchase.

Red flags that trigger caution

Be alert to several warning signs that suggest higher risk. Vague or missing return policies, no physical contact information, limited or no reviewer feedback, and inconsistent branding across pages all point to potential problems. Extremely aggressive discounts or guarantees that sound too good to be true merit skepticism. If the platform pressures you to place orders quickly or discourages dispute processes, that's a red flag. Another red flag is lack of clear seller onboarding information or opaque fees beyond the base price. If you notice any of these signs, pause and conduct deeper checks or opt for a more transparent alternative. Shipping, fulfillment times, and international orders

Shipping reliability is often the most tangible element of trust. Evaluate stated processing times, carriers used, and the tracking capabilities offered. International orders introduce additional complexity with customs and duties; ensure the policy clearly explains these charges and delivery timelines. Verify if the platform provides order protection for late or damaged shipments, and whether local sellers ship to your region. Real-world fulfillment performance depends on seller logistics, stock availability, and printing turnaround. A credible marketplace should publish average fulfillment windows and have a dispute mechanism if timelines slip or products arrive defective. What to do before you buy: a step-by-step checklist

  1. Read the listing in detail and compare it against other sellers. 2) Check the seller’s profile for ratings and response times. 3) Verify the platform’s refund and shipping policies. 4) Confirm secure checkout and accepted payment methods. 5) Review privacy disclosures and data handling. 6) Look for independent reviews and third-party mentions. 7) Contact the seller with a few questions and note response quality. 8) Place a small test order to evaluate fulfillment. 9) Save all order-related communications for potential disputes. 10) If anything feels off, pause and seek alternatives. 11) After the purchase, monitor tracking and promptly report issues.
